pkgsrc-Changes-HG arch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
[pkgsrc/trunk]: pkgsrc *: finish move of botan to versioned directories
details: https://anonhg.NetBSD.org/pkgsrc/rev/2d9e29e8e2b9
branches: trunk
changeset: 376039:2d9e29e8e2b9
user: wiz <wiz%pkgsrc.org@localhost>
date: Fri Apr 01 08:07:28 2022 +0000
description:
*: finish move of botan to versioned directories
diffstat:
devel/monotone/Makefile | 7 +-
net/powerdns/options.mk | 4 +-
security/Makefile | 6 +-
security/botan-devel/DESCR | 13 -
security/botan-devel/Makefile | 68 -
security/botan-devel/PLIST | 388 ----------
security/botan-devel/buildlink3.mk | 16 -
security/botan-devel/distinfo | 8 -
security/botan-devel/patches/patch-configure.py | 16 -
security/botan-devel/patches/patch-src_build-data_os_openbsd.txt | 15 -
security/botan-devel/patches/patch-src_lib_utils_os__utils.cpp | 29 -
security/botan/DESCR | 12 -
security/botan/Makefile | 50 -
security/botan/PLIST | 266 ------
security/botan/buildlink3.mk | 12 -
security/botan/distinfo | 16 -
security/botan/patches/patch-src_build-data_arch_arm.txt | 12 -
security/botan/patches/patch-src_build-data_makefile_unix.in | 31 -
security/botan/patches/patch-src_build-data_makefile_unix__shr.in | 31 -
security/botan/patches/patch-src_build-data_os_solaris.txt | 16 -
security/botan/patches/patch-src_entropy_unix_procs_info.txt | 12 -
security/botan/patches/patch-src_ssl_rec__wri.cpp | 13 -
security/botan/patches/patch-src_ssl_tls__client.cpp | 15 -
security/botan/patches/patch-src_ssl_tls__client.h | 24 -
security/botan/patches/patch-src_ssl_tls__record.h | 45 -
security/botan/patches/patch-src_ssl_tls__server.cpp | 15 -
security/botan/patches/patch-src_ssl_tls__server.h | 24 -
security/keepassxc/Makefile | 6 +-
security/opendnssec/options.mk | 3 +-
security/opendnssec2/options.mk | 3 +-
security/softhsm/Makefile | 7 +-
security/softhsm/buildlink3.mk | 4 +-
security/softhsm2/Makefile | 7 +-
security/softhsm2/buildlink3.mk | 4 +-
34 files changed, 23 insertions(+), 1175 deletions(-)
diffs (truncated from 1439 to 300 lines):
diff -r 6f710d9a4330 -r 2d9e29e8e2b9 devel/monotone/Makefile
--- a/devel/monotone/Makefile Fri Apr 01 08:06:26 2022 +0000
+++ b/devel/monotone/Makefile Fri Apr 01 08:07:28 2022 +0000
@@ -1,7 +1,7 @@
-# $NetBSD: Makefile,v 1.120 2021/12/08 16:04:02 adam Exp $
+# $NetBSD: Makefile,v 1.121 2022/04/01 08:07:28 wiz Exp $
DISTNAME= monotone-1.1
-PKGREVISION= 27
+PKGREVISION= 28
CATEGORIES= devel scm
MASTER_SITES= http://www.monotone.ca/downloads/1.1/
EXTRACT_SUFX= .tar.bz2
@@ -56,7 +56,6 @@
.include "../../devel/pcre/buildlink3.mk"
.include "../../devel/zlib/buildlink3.mk"
.include "../../lang/lua/buildlink3.mk"
-# botan-devel is probably also fine
-.include "../../security/botan/buildlink3.mk"
+.include "../../security/botan1/buildlink3.mk"
.include "../../mk/pthread.buildlink3.mk"
.include "../../mk/bsd.pkg.mk"
diff -r 6f710d9a4330 -r 2d9e29e8e2b9 net/powerdns/options.mk
--- a/net/powerdns/options.mk Fri Apr 01 08:06:26 2022 +0000
+++ b/net/powerdns/options.mk Fri Apr 01 08:07:28 2022 +0000
@@ -1,4 +1,4 @@
-# $NetBSD: options.mk,v 1.8 2020/07/02 13:01:38 otis Exp $
+# $NetBSD: options.mk,v 1.9 2022/04/01 08:07:28 wiz Exp $
PKG_OPTIONS_VAR= PKG_OPTIONS.powerdns
PKG_SUPPORTED_OPTIONS= bind botan luarecords pipe random remote sqlite tools zeromq
@@ -15,7 +15,7 @@
.if !empty(PKG_OPTIONS:Mbotan)
.include "../../devel/gmp/buildlink3.mk"
-.include "../../security/botan-devel/buildlink3.mk"
+.include "../../security/botan2/buildlink3.mk"
.endif
.if !empty(PKG_OPTIONS:Mluarecords)
diff -r 6f710d9a4330 -r 2d9e29e8e2b9 security/Makefile
--- a/security/Makefile Fri Apr 01 08:06:26 2022 +0000
+++ b/security/Makefile Fri Apr 01 08:07:28 2022 +0000
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.851 2022/03/15 18:18:55 nia Exp $
+# $NetBSD: Makefile,v 1.852 2022/04/01 08:07:28 wiz Exp $
#
COMMENT= Security and cryptography tools and libraries
@@ -39,8 +39,8 @@
SUBDIR+= bearssl
SUBDIR+= beecrypt
SUBDIR+= bitstir
-SUBDIR+= botan
-SUBDIR+= botan-devel
+SUBDIR+= botan1
+SUBDIR+= botan2
SUBDIR+= ca-certificates
SUBDIR+= caff
SUBDIR+= ccid
diff -r 6f710d9a4330 -r 2d9e29e8e2b9 security/botan-devel/DESCR
--- a/security/botan-devel/DESCR Fri Apr 01 08:06:26 2022 +0000
+++ /dev/null Thu Jan 01 00:00:00 1970 +0000
@@ -1,13 +0,0 @@
-Botan is a crypto library written in C++. It provides a variety of
-cryptographic algorithms, including common ones such as AES, MD5, SHA,
-HMAC, RSA, Diffie-Hellman, DSA, and ECDSA, as well as many others that
-are more obscure or specialized. It also offers X.509v3 certificates
-and CRLs, and PKCS #10 certificate requests. A message processing
-system that uses a filter/pipeline metaphor allows for many common
-cryptographic tasks to be completed with just a few lines of code.
-Assembly optimizations for common CPUs, including x86, x86-64, and
-PowerPC, offers further speedups for critical tasks such as SHA-1
-hashing and multiple precision integer operations.
-
-The development version contains a much improved TLS infrastructure.
-It also depends on C++11.
diff -r 6f710d9a4330 -r 2d9e29e8e2b9 security/botan-devel/Makefile
--- a/security/botan-devel/Makefile Fri Apr 01 08:06:26 2022 +0000
+++ /dev/null Thu Jan 01 00:00:00 1970 +0000
@@ -1,68 +0,0 @@
-# $NetBSD: Makefile,v 1.45 2022/03/31 23:24:22 wiz Exp $
-
-DISTNAME= Botan-2.19.1
-PKGNAME= ${DISTNAME:tl}
-CATEGORIES= security
-MASTER_SITES= https://botan.randombit.net/releases/
-EXTRACT_SUFX= .tar.xz
-
-MAINTAINER= joerg%NetBSD.org@localhost
-HOMEPAGE= https://botan.randombit.net/
-COMMENT= Portable, easy to use, and efficient C++ crypto library
-LICENSE= 2-clause-bsd
-
-HAS_CONFIGURE= yes
-USE_LANGUAGES= c++
-
-PYTHON_FOR_BUILD_ONLY= yes
-
-CONFIG_SHELL= ${PYTHONBIN}
-CONFIGURE_SCRIPT= ./configure.py
-CONFIGURE_ARGS+= --prefix=${PREFIX} --with-zlib --with-boost
-CONFIGURE_ARGS+= --docdir=share/doc
-CONFIGURE_ARGS+= --without-sphinx
-
-REPLACE_PYTHON+= *.py src/scripts/*.py
-
-.include "../../mk/compiler.mk"
-.if !empty(PKGSRC_COMPILER:Mclang)
-CONFIGURE_ARGS+= --cc-bin=${CXX} --cc=clang
-.else
-CONFIGURE_ARGS+= --cc=gcc
-.endif
-
-PLIST_VARS+= x86
-.if ${MACHINE_ARCH} == "x86_64"
-PLIST.x86= yes
-CONFIGURE_ARGS+= --cpu=amd64
-.elif ${MACHINE_ARCH} == "i386"
-PLIST.x86= yes
-CONFIGURE_ARGS+= --cpu=i386
-.elif ${MACHINE_ARCH} == "powerpc"
-CONFIGURE_ARGS+= --cpu=ppc
-.elif ${MACHINE_ARCH} == "powerpc64"
-CONFIGURE_ARGS+= --cpu=ppc64
-.elif !empty(MACHINE_ARCH:Maarch64*)
-CONFIGURE_ARGS+= --cpu=arm64
-.elif !empty(MACHINE_ARCH:Mearm*)
-CONFIGURE_ARGS+= --cpu=arm32
-.endif
-
-MAKE_FLAGS+= LIB_OPT=${CXXFLAGS:Q}
-
-USE_TOOLS+= gmake
-
-PY_PATCHPLIST= yes
-
-LDFLAGS.SunOS+= -lnsl -lsocket
-
-TEST_TARGET= tests
-
-post-test:
- cd ${WRKSRC} && ./botan-test
-
-.include "../../devel/zlib/buildlink3.mk"
-.include "../../devel/boost-libs/buildlink3.mk"
-.include "../../lang/python/application.mk"
-.include "../../lang/python/extension.mk"
-.include "../../mk/bsd.pkg.mk"
diff -r 6f710d9a4330 -r 2d9e29e8e2b9 security/botan-devel/PLIST
--- a/security/botan-devel/PLIST Fri Apr 01 08:06:26 2022 +0000
+++ /dev/null Thu Jan 01 00:00:00 1970 +0000
@@ -1,388 +0,0 @@
-@comment $NetBSD: PLIST,v 1.13 2022/03/31 23:24:22 wiz Exp $
-bin/botan
-include/botan-2/botan/adler32.h
-include/botan-2/botan/aead.h
-include/botan-2/botan/aes.h
-include/botan-2/botan/alg_id.h
-include/botan-2/botan/argon2.h
-include/botan-2/botan/aria.h
-include/botan-2/botan/asio_async_ops.h
-include/botan-2/botan/asio_context.h
-include/botan-2/botan/asio_error.h
-include/botan-2/botan/asio_stream.h
-include/botan-2/botan/asn1_alt_name.h
-include/botan-2/botan/asn1_attribute.h
-include/botan-2/botan/asn1_obj.h
-include/botan-2/botan/asn1_oid.h
-include/botan-2/botan/asn1_print.h
-include/botan-2/botan/asn1_str.h
-include/botan-2/botan/asn1_time.h
-include/botan-2/botan/assert.h
-include/botan-2/botan/auto_rng.h
-include/botan-2/botan/b64_filt.h
-include/botan-2/botan/base32.h
-include/botan-2/botan/base58.h
-include/botan-2/botan/base64.h
-include/botan-2/botan/basefilt.h
-include/botan-2/botan/bcrypt.h
-include/botan-2/botan/bcrypt_pbkdf.h
-include/botan-2/botan/ber_dec.h
-include/botan-2/botan/bigint.h
-include/botan-2/botan/blake2b.h
-include/botan-2/botan/blinding.h
-include/botan-2/botan/block_cipher.h
-include/botan-2/botan/blowfish.h
-include/botan-2/botan/botan.h
-include/botan-2/botan/bswap.h
-include/botan-2/botan/buf_comp.h
-include/botan-2/botan/buf_filt.h
-include/botan-2/botan/build.h
-include/botan-2/botan/calendar.h
-include/botan-2/botan/camellia.h
-include/botan-2/botan/cascade.h
-include/botan-2/botan/cast128.h
-include/botan-2/botan/cast256.h
-include/botan-2/botan/cbc.h
-include/botan-2/botan/cbc_mac.h
-include/botan-2/botan/ccm.h
-include/botan-2/botan/cecpq1.h
-include/botan-2/botan/cert_status.h
-include/botan-2/botan/certstor.h
-include/botan-2/botan/certstor_flatfile.h
-include/botan-2/botan/certstor_sql.h
-include/botan-2/botan/certstor_system.h
-include/botan-2/botan/cfb.h
-include/botan-2/botan/chacha.h
-include/botan-2/botan/chacha20poly1305.h
-include/botan-2/botan/chacha_rng.h
-include/botan-2/botan/charset.h
-include/botan-2/botan/cipher_filter.h
-include/botan-2/botan/cipher_mode.h
-include/botan-2/botan/cmac.h
-include/botan-2/botan/comb4p.h
-include/botan-2/botan/comp_filter.h
-include/botan-2/botan/compiler.h
-include/botan-2/botan/compression.h
-include/botan-2/botan/cpuid.h
-include/botan-2/botan/crc24.h
-include/botan-2/botan/crc32.h
-include/botan-2/botan/credentials_manager.h
-include/botan-2/botan/crl_ent.h
-include/botan-2/botan/cryptobox.h
-include/botan-2/botan/ctr.h
-include/botan-2/botan/curve25519.h
-include/botan-2/botan/curve_gfp.h
-include/botan-2/botan/curve_nistp.h
-include/botan-2/botan/data_snk.h
-include/botan-2/botan/data_src.h
-include/botan-2/botan/database.h
-include/botan-2/botan/datastor.h
-include/botan-2/botan/der_enc.h
-include/botan-2/botan/des.h
-include/botan-2/botan/desx.h
-include/botan-2/botan/dh.h
-include/botan-2/botan/divide.h
-include/botan-2/botan/dl_algo.h
-include/botan-2/botan/dl_group.h
-include/botan-2/botan/dlies.h
-include/botan-2/botan/dsa.h
-include/botan-2/botan/dyn_load.h
-include/botan-2/botan/eax.h
-include/botan-2/botan/ec_group.h
-include/botan-2/botan/ecc_key.h
-include/botan-2/botan/ecdh.h
-include/botan-2/botan/ecdsa.h
-include/botan-2/botan/ecgdsa.h
-include/botan-2/botan/ecies.h
-include/botan-2/botan/eckcdsa.h
-include/botan-2/botan/ed25519.h
-include/botan-2/botan/elgamal.h
-include/botan-2/botan/eme.h
-include/botan-2/botan/eme_pkcs.h
-include/botan-2/botan/eme_raw.h
-include/botan-2/botan/emsa.h
-include/botan-2/botan/emsa1.h
-include/botan-2/botan/emsa_pkcs1.h
-include/botan-2/botan/emsa_raw.h
-include/botan-2/botan/emsa_x931.h
-include/botan-2/botan/entropy_src.h
-include/botan-2/botan/exceptn.h
-include/botan-2/botan/fd_unix.h
-include/botan-2/botan/ffi.h
-include/botan-2/botan/filter.h
-include/botan-2/botan/filters.h
-include/botan-2/botan/fpe_fe1.h
-include/botan-2/botan/gcm.h
-include/botan-2/botan/gf2m_small_m.h
-include/botan-2/botan/ghash.h
-include/botan-2/botan/gmac.h
-include/botan-2/botan/gost_28147.h
-include/botan-2/botan/gost_3410.h
-include/botan-2/botan/gost_3411.h
-include/botan-2/botan/hash.h
-include/botan-2/botan/hash_id.h
-include/botan-2/botan/hex.h
-include/botan-2/botan/hex_filt.h
-include/botan-2/botan/hkdf.h
-include/botan-2/botan/hmac.h
-include/botan-2/botan/hmac_drbg.h
-include/botan-2/botan/hotp.h
-include/botan-2/botan/http_util.h
-include/botan-2/botan/idea.h
-include/botan-2/botan/init.h
-include/botan-2/botan/iso9796.h
-include/botan-2/botan/kasumi.h
-include/botan-2/botan/kdf.h
-include/botan-2/botan/kdf1.h
-include/botan-2/botan/kdf1_iso18033.h
-include/botan-2/botan/kdf2.h
-include/botan-2/botan/keccak.h
-include/botan-2/botan/key_constraint.h
-include/botan-2/botan/key_filt.h
-include/botan-2/botan/key_spec.h
-include/botan-2/botan/keypair.h
-include/botan-2/botan/lion.h
-include/botan-2/botan/loadstor.h
-include/botan-2/botan/locking_allocator.h
-include/botan-2/botan/lookup.h
Home |
Main Index |
Thread Index |
Old Index